The Paradox of Liberation
This chapter examines how societal changes, though initially perceived as liberating, can give rise to new forms of oppression, using historical examples like modern science and the sexual revolution. It critiques false consciousness and how media narratives shape public perception, challenging the alignment between individual interests and societal conditioning.
